1. Understanding Hyperhidrosis

Hyperhidrosis is a medical condition characterized by excessive sweating beyond what is necessary for regulating body temperature. It can occur in specific areas of the body, such as the underarms, palms, feet, or face, or it may affect the entire body. Hyperhidrosis can be primary, with no underlying medical cause, or secondary, resulting from an underlying medical condition or medication side effect.

2. How Botox Works for Hyperhidrosis

Botox, or botulinum toxin type A, works by blocking the signals that stimulate sweat glands, thereby reducing the production of sweat in the treated area. When injected into the skin, Botox temporarily paralyzes the nerves that control sweating, providing relief from excessive sweating for several months. The effects of Botox typically last for six to twelve months, depending on the individual and the treatment area.

3. Treatment Areas for Hyperhidrosis

Botox injections can be used to treat hyperhidrosis in various areas of the body, including:

  • Underarms: Excessive sweating in the underarms, also known as axillary hyperhidrosis, can be particularly bothersome and embarrassing. Botox injections in the underarm area can effectively reduce sweating and improve overall comfort and confidence.

  • Palms: Palmar hyperhidrosis, or excessive sweating of the palms, can make simple tasks like shaking hands or holding objects challenging. Botox injections in the palms can help reduce sweating and improve grip strength and dexterity.

  • Feet: Excessive sweating of the feet, known as plantar hyperhidrosis, can lead to foot odor, discomfort, and skin infections. Botox injections in the soles of the feet can help control sweating and prevent these complications.

  • Face: Facial hyperhidrosis can cause excessive sweating of the forehead, upper lip, or other areas of the face, leading to discomfort and social anxiety. Botox injections in the affected areas can help reduce sweating and improve overall comfort and confidence.

4. Botox Treatment Procedure

The Botox treatment procedure for hyperhidrosis is relatively simple and minimally invasive. It involves a series of small injections of Botox solution directly into the skin of the affected area. The procedure is performed in-office and typically takes less than 30 minutes to complete. Patients may experience mild discomfort or a stinging sensation during the injections, but this is usually well-tolerated.

FAQs

  1. Is Botox treatment painful for hyperhidrosis?

    • Botox injections for hyperhidrosis may cause mild discomfort or a stinging sensation during the procedure, but this is usually well-tolerated by most patients. Topical anesthesia or ice packs may be used to minimize discomfort during the injections.
  2. How long does it take to see results from Botox treatment for hyperhidrosis?

    • Patients typically begin to notice a reduction in sweating within a few days to a week after Botox treatment for hyperhidrosis. The full effects of the treatment usually develop within two weeks and can last for six to twelve months.
  3. Are there any side effects of Botox treatment for hyperhidrosis?

    • While Botox treatment for hyperhidrosis is generally safe, some patients may experience mild side effects such as temporary bruising, swelling, or redness at the injection sites. These side effects typically resolve on their own within a few days to a week after treatment.
  4. How often do I need to repeat Botox treatments for hyperhidrosis?

    • The frequency of Botox treatments for hyperhidrosis may vary depending on individual factors such as the severity of sweating and the treatment area. In general, repeat treatments are necessary every six to twelve months to maintain the desired results.
  5. Can Botox treatment for hyperhidrosis be covered by insurance?

    • In some cases, Botox treatment for hyperhidrosis may be covered by insurance if it is deemed medically necessary. Patients should check with their insurance provider to determine their coverage options and eligibility for reimbursement.
